Nandankanan Entry Fee Hiked By Rs 10

Bhubaneswar: The visitors to Nandankanan Zoological Park in the outskirts of the city will have to pay a slightly higher fee for entry as the authorities have decided to increase the fee to Rs 50 from Rs 40 per head for adults.

The revision of ticket costs shall come into effect from April 1.

However, the entry fee for children below 15 years of age shall remain unchanged (Rs 10 per head), according to zoo sources.

No fee shall be levied for use of toilet and drinking water facilities, the sources said.

The entry fee of the animal park and the adjacent botanical garden was earlier enhanced to Rs 40 to Rs 25 on June 1, 2017.
